Standard & Poor's Crisil buys KPO services firm Pipal

INDIA— Knowledge process outsourcing (KPO) firm Pipal Research has been bought by Standard & Poor’s Crisil in a deal worth US$12.75m.

Pipal is based in Chicago and provides business research and investment research services. Its marketing analytics offering includes customer segmentation, web analytics and marketing optimisation, as well as data and text mining and statistical data analysis.

It operates a custom research business called PipalAnswers.

Crisil already owns a KPO business, Irevna. Roopa Kudva, CEO of Crisil, said the acquisition of Pipal “enables us to further strengthen our leadership position in the high-end KPO space”.
